The enduring question : Intelligence: Nature vs. Nurture

The intriguing question of whether intelligence is primarily determined by genetics or nurture has occupied researchers and the general public for centuries. Supporters of the inherited viewpoint maintain that we are born with are largely encoded in our DNA. Conversely, those who champion the nurture perspective maintain that our surroundings during childhood have a dominant influence on intelligence.

This discussion is further fueled by the recognition that both both sides interact with each other in shaping intelligence. Ultimately, future research will likely reveal a complex combination of both factors that influence an individual's intellectual potential.

Unveiling the Spectrum of Intelligence

Traditional assessments often emphasize solely on intellectual ability as measured by IQ scores. However, this restricted view fails to capture the comprehensive range of human capability. Howard Gardner's theory of multiple intelligences revolutionized our perception of intelligence by suggesting that individuals possess distinct strengths in various areas.

By embracing these diverse intelligences, educators are able to adapt their teaching approaches to address the unique needs of each student.
